WebApr 13, 2024 · The 5 Vet-Approved Food Sources of Vitamin C for Cats. 1. Strawberries. Image Credit: Engin_Akyurt, Pixabay. Strawberries are safe and healthy treats for cats and contain many vitamins and minerals, including vitamin C. There are 58 mg of vitamin C in every 100 grams of strawberries. We will discuss each case right here. Raw ... WebFeb 5, 2024 · Yes! Rabbits can have brussel sprouts, but only in small amounts, and only as an occasional treat. There are a couple of reasons for this: First, brussels sprouts are a “gassy” vegetable and rabbits aren’t capable of passing gas, so it creates serious discomfort for them if it forms in their digestive tract.
